Hi, ever since about a week ago my signal has gone from bad to almost nothing. I'm lucky to get 1 bar of G and sometimes I get nothing indoors or even in shops. I can get 3G if outside in a strong signal area like town centre. My GF got hers about a month ago and mine is from December 2012. I'm on EE and she's on Orange EE. Phone set to 3G max, done a hard reset, soft reset and switch flight mode on and off as well. Running 1308.

EDIT: Our OS Version, Firmware revision, Hardware revision, Radio software version and Chip SOC version are both the same.

Oh and I swapped the sims, so pretty sure it's the phone

I think this is elaborately discussed in more than one threads about 1308 update. Even the UK 1308 update thread discusses this. The way AT&T has got their own 1314 update by Nokia, the rest of the world needs this OS. The reason it isn't such a big outcry as AT&T users is because it affects most of the phones that run on a network that is 3G & 4G. There aren't many 4G networks around the globe yet. In the UK, it's only EE and I will be surprised if more EE customers (Orange and Tmobile too!) haven't noticed this horrible connectivity. I am not sure what other countries around the globe have 4G, but 1308 on those network handsets will cause the same sort of chaos. I have hopelessly tweeted Nokia a LOT of time and even sent emails to Nokia but they have only released 1314 for AT&T customers because it was a huge number and clearly visible. The rest of us seem to be in minority and Nokia doesn't see this as a problem at all. Our best bet is we get this patched when we get GDR2 from Microsoft in July. I have 4 920s in the house and I've so far had spare time to downgrade two of those. How I've done it is - from Navifirm get the old 1249 firmware. Save it in ProgramData/Nokia/Packages/Products/RM-821 : this will give some sort of overwrite dialogue and say yes. Then when you go and flash your Lumia 920 through NCS 5.0, you will see 1249 firmware as a choice to flash on your phone. From there on it's one of the simple procedures really. You will be asked if you want to download an update once you have 1249 - this is OTA notification on phone, just say no! Or better if you untick boxes for find updates/download automatically in settings - phone update, once you have flashed 1249 successfully.
